[N3041] Alvin A. Torzewski
June 13, 1923 - July 7, 2005
South Bend Tribune 7/9/2005
Alvin A. Torzewski, 82, of South Bend, Indiana, passed away Thursday, July 7, 2005, at Hospice House in South Bend. Mr. Torzewski was born on June 13, 1923, in South Bend, Indiana to Stanley and Bernice (Grzezinski) Torzewski. He retired from the South Bend Fire Department as a firefighter on September 14, 1987, after 38 years of service. On June 14, 1952, Alvin married Beverly J. Smith, who survives. Surviving with his wife of 53 years are his children, Mary Ann (Stanley) Korabek of Granger, Brian Torzewski of South Bend, Mark (Michele) Torzewski of South Bend, David Torzewski of Mishawaka; grandchildren, Stephanie (Ryan), Jacqueline, Allison, Mark, Matthew, Michael and Kaitlin; sisters, Monica Peak, Virginia (Roman) Szymczak; and brothers, Modest (Velma) Torzewski, and Jerome (Barbara) Torzewski. A brother, Daniel Torzewski preceded him in death. Visitation will be held from 2 to 8 p.m. Sunday, July 10, 2005, in the Kaniewski Funeral Home, 3545 N. Bendix Drive, South Bend, Indiana, where a Rosary will be held at 5 p.m. A Mass of Christian Burial will be celebrated at 10 a.m. Monday, July 11, 2005, in St. Jude Catholic Church, South Bend, with burial to follow at Highland Cemetery. Mr. Torzewski was a member of St. Jude Parish, was a World War II Navy veteran, a member of the Veterans of Foreign Wars, and the P.N.A. # 83.
